Studying Risk Factors for Type 2 Diabetes in Youth

Study Leader

Elizabeth Jensen, PhD


I'm Interested En español
Skip Jump Links

    About This Study

    Type 2 diabetes is a health problem where the body has too much sugar in the blood. This study wants to find out what makes young people more likely to get this condition early. The information we learn will help us create future studies on how to stop and treat type 2 diabetes in young people.

    Girl volunteers must be aged 9-13 years old and boy volunteers must be 10-14 years old. Study team will provide more information.
